Short Description
Syntran Capsule is an antifungal medication used to treat infections of the mouth, throat, vagina, and other parts of the body including fingernails and toenails.

Introduction
Syntran Capsule should be taken in the dose and duration as prescribed by your doctor. It should be swallowed whole and can be taken with food. To get the most benefit, take this medicine at evenly spaced times and continue using it until your prescription is finished, even if your symptoms disappear after a few days. If you stop the treatment too early, the infection may return and if you miss doses you can increase your risk of infections that are resistant to further treatment. Tell your doctor if the infection does not get better or if it gets worse.

Frequently asked questions
What is Syntran Capsule used for?
Syntran Capsule is used to treat fungal infections caused by Trichophyton spp., Microsporum spp., and Epidermophyton floccosum. The infections may be ringworm, infection of the feet, or infection in the groin and buttocks. This medicine also treats persistent infections of fingernails and toenails, persistent candida (yeast) infections of the vagina or candidiasis (yeast) infections of the mouth or throat in patients with lower disease resistance. It is also used in the treatment of cryptococcal infection and infections caused by Histoplasma, aspergillus, and Blastomyces.
For how long do I need to take Syntran Capsule?
The dose and length of treatment depends on the type and site of infection and your response to the treatment. For example, if you are taking Syntran Capsule for athlete's foot (fungal infection of the skin on the feet and between the toes), the dose may need to be taken for 30 days, on the other hand, if you are taking it for candidal infection of the vagina, the dose may span from 1 day to 3 days depending on the dosage advised by the doctor.
I am taking Syntran Capsule for nail infection but there does not seem to be any improvement. Can I stop taking it?
No, you should not stop taking Syntran Capsule without completing the entire course because doing so may not completely cure the fungal infection. It usually takes about 6-9 months for nail lesions to disappear because after the medicine eliminates the fungus, the new nail takes several months to grow. Do not worry if you do not see any improvement during the treatment.
Why has my doctor asked me to get blood tests done?
Your doctor is probably trying to monitor your liver’s functioning. Syntran Capsule may cause serious liver damage. Therefore, if you develop loss of appetite, nausea, vomiting, dark urine, or abdominal pain while taking Syntran Capsule, you should tell your doctor immediately.
Can I take antacid and Syntran Capsule together?
Syntran Capsule can be utilized by the body if there is sufficient acid in the stomach. Medicines for stomach ulcers, heartburn, or indigestion neutralize the acid produced by the stomach. Therefore, take antacids or any such medicine about 2 hours after taking Syntran Capsule. If you are taking antacids (medicines that stop the production of stomach acid), take Syntran Capsule capsules with a drink of cola.
What is drug resistance? Is it possible to develop resistance to Syntran Capsule?
Sometimes it happens that the fungi get modified in your body and the medicine no longer works. This is called drug resistance. Resistance to Syntran Capsule has been reported with some candida species (krusei, glabrata, and tropicalis). Syntran Capsule should not be used for infection caused due to these species. Take the complete course of Syntran Capsule to avoid drug resistance.
I have been on alprazolam for quite some time. Is it okay if I start Syntran Capsule now?
Yes, you can take both Alprazolam and Syntran Capsule together, but keep a watch on the side effects of alprazolam such as lightheadedness or drowsiness. If side effects appear after taking Syntran Capsule, talk to your doctor who will modify the dose of alprazolam.
My doctor prescribed Syntran Capsule to me but not to my friend who had a similar fungal infection because she was on dofetilide. Why is it so?
Your doctor did not prescribe Syntran Capsule to your friend because Syntran Capsule interferes with the working of dofetilide. This interference can cause disturbed electrical activity of the heart, which can be harmful to the patient.
